【電子書籍なら、スマホ・パソコンの無料アプリで今すぐ読める!】Dickory Cronke: The Dumb Philosopher, or, Great Britain's Wonder【電子書籍】[ Daniel Defoe ]
<p>The novella is a fictionalized biography of its titular character, Dickory Cronke. The story is presented as a narrative written by Dickory himself, who is depicted as a man with a speech impediment. He is known locally as "the dumb philosopher" because of his inability to speak clearly, but his narrative reveals his keen observations and his philosophy on life. Dickory's life story takes readers through his adventures, travels, and experiences in 17th-century England.The novella is relatively short and is notable for its exploration of themes such as individuality, the human spirit, and the value of a unique perspective on the world. It's a character-driven work that offers insights into the life and thoughts of its protagonist."Dickory Cronke" is not as widely read as some of Daniel Defoe's other works, like "Robinson Crusoe" or "Moll Flanders," but it remains an interesting and lesser-known piece of Defoe's literary output. It provides a glimpse into the diversity of Defoe's writing beyond his more famous adventure novels.</p>画面が切り替わりますので、しばらくお待ち下さい。 ※ご購入は、楽天kobo商品ページからお願いします。※切り替わらない場合は、こちら をクリックして下さい。 ※このページからは注文できません。

【電子書籍なら、スマホ・パソコンの無料アプリで今すぐ読める!】Wonder and Cruelty Ontological War in It’s a Wonderful Life【電子書籍】[ Steven Johnston ]
<p>It’s a Wonderful Life is an American film classic celebrated for its inspirational character. Famously shown during the holiday season, it brings families together in the spirit of mutual love and support. It tells the story of George Bailey, who turns suicidal one Christmas Eve after decades of frustration and sacrifice in which his dreams are repeatedly shattered for the good of others. George is convinced that his life is anything but wonderful. Enter Clarence, his guardian angel, who must find a way to get George to appreciate his family, friends, and all the good he does in life. Clarence does find a way and George returns to his family at film’s close. This might seem like a fairy-tale ending, but it is anything but convincing, which should come as no surprise since the film rehearses an ontological war between contending parties with rival conceptions of what it means to lead a meaningful life. It is a rather one-sided conflict as George finds himself more or less alone in the world. He has been trying to escape his hometown his entire life in order to pursue his Promethean vision in the wider world. To prevent this, God dispatches Clarence to get George to heel. He resorts to a kind of transcendental terrorism to force George to return home and believe it was his own idea. Yet what does it say about a form of life when it resorts to such means to prevail in an existential contest? From a Nietzschean perspective, it is possible to illuminate the film’s extraordinary cruelty. Despite appearances, George’s restoration is temporary at best and there is every reason to believe that eventually he will try to take his life again. Tragically, George must leave Bedford Falls and those who love him must insist that he go.</p>画面が切り替わりますので、しばらくお待ち下さい。 ※ご購入は、楽天kobo商品ページからお願いします。※切り替わらない場合は、こちら をクリックして下さい。 ※このページからは注文できません。

【電子書籍なら、スマホ・パソコンの無料アプリで今すぐ読める!】A Nine Days' Wonder【電子書籍】[ Bithia Mary Croker ]
<p>A tall grey-haired soldier, with a professionally straight back, stood looking out of an upper window in the “Rag” one wet October afternoon. His hands were buried in his pockets, and his face was clothed with an expression of almost medi?val gloom. The worldly wise mask their emotions so that those who run may not read, but Colonel Doran had lived so many years among a primitive race that he made no effort to conceal his feelings, and all the world was welcome to see that he was bored to death. To tell the truth, he had been too long in the East to appreciate club life. Other men were undoubtedly contented, interested, occupied; it was different in his case. The palatial dignity, solemnity, luxury of the place failed to stir his pride; even its traditions left him as cold as the marble statue on the great staircase. He would have felt ten times more at home in a Bombay chair, on a brick verandah, with the old Pioneer in his hands and a “Trichy” in his mouth. The big smoking-room below had presented a most animated scene; groups of old brother officers were discussing various burning questions, and topics ranged, from the new Hussar boot, to the North-west Frontier. Colonel Doran knew a good deal about the frontier, but made no effort to enter the lists. What were possible campaigns to him now? He wandered aimlessly up to the library, and turned over some books; he tried to readーit was no use. Ashamed to appear a sort of no man’s friend, and stray, he made his way to the upper smoking-room, which he was tolerably certain to find empty at that hour. He sauntered round it, gazing indifferently at the pictures and mementoes. A sketch of two elephants in a dust-storm arrested his attention. How he wished himself on the back of one of the old beggarsーdust-storm and all! At last he strolled over to the window, and as he stood looking out on a dismal vista of wet slates and an iron-grey sky he heaved an involuntary sigh. So this was the end of his careerーidleness, boredom, solitude! The career of Ulick Doran had commenced at eighteen, when as a cadet he had landed in Indiaーthat hospitable godmother of younger sonsーand the kindly East had adopted and made him her own for the better part of thirty-four years. He had been gazetted as a mere boy to a crack regiment of Bengal cavalry known as “Holland’s Horse,” and in this corps, his home, he had lived and fought and nearly died: had seen his comrades come and go, marry, and retire. Now it was his own turn. At fifty-two his career was ended, and the curtain rung down. Good-bye to everything he cared forーto the sowars, his children, to the mess, to the horse lines, aye, to the very horses, half of which he had selectedーgood-bye to all that had made life worth living. Naturally he could not remain in India, that unseemly spectacle, a mere camp follower of the regiment he had so ably commanded, hovering around it like a departed spirit. He must return to England, and range himself decently on the shelf along with most of his contemporaries. Unfortunately Colonel Doran had but few resources apart from his profession; he was a fine horseman, a noted swordsman, a keen and capable officer, and here he stood, a stranded and unhappy pensioner, the very typical dragoon without his horse! What made his position still worse, he was alone in the world. His mother had died when he was a small boyーhe scarcely remembered her; his father, on the other hand, had lived to a great age, a red-faced, irascible old gentleman, whose eldest son predeceased him by many years; and thus the family place had come to the Indian officer, after all.</p>画面が切り替わりますので、しばらくお待ち下さい。 ※ご購入は、楽天kobo商品ページからお願いします。※切り替わらない場合は、こちら をクリックして下さい。 ※このページからは注文できません。

【電子書籍なら、スマホ・パソコンの無料アプリで今すぐ読める!】Explore China's Rich Heritage and Modern Wonders: A Travel Guide for the Adventurous Spirit A comprehensive travel guide to China【電子書籍】[ Tracey P. Leonard ]
<p>China is a vast and diverse country with a rich history and culture dating back thousands of years. From the ancient Great Wall to the modern metropolis of Shanghai, there is no shortage of interesting and unique experiences to be had in this fascinating country.</p> <p>For those with a love of history and culture, China has much to offer. The Great Wall, a UNESCO World Heritage Site, stretches for over 13,000 miles and is a testament to the ingenuity and determination of the Chinese people. The Forbidden City in Beijing, the former imperial palace of the Ming and Qing dynasties, is another must-see attraction. This massive complex of palaces, gardens, and temples is a testament to China's imperial past and is a breathtaking example of traditional Chinese architecture.</p> <p>But China is not all about the past. The country has also embraced the future and is home to some of the most modern and technologically advanced cities in the world. Shanghai, for example, is a bustling metropolis with a skyline filled with towering skyscrapers. The city is also home to the Shanghai World Financial Center, one of the tallest buildings in the world.</p> <p>For those interested in natural beauty, China has much to offer as well. The country is home to a number of stunning landscapes, including the towering peaks of the Himalayas, the lush forests of the Yunnan province, and the beautiful beaches of Hainan Island.</p> <p>No matter what your interests, there is something for everyone in China. The country is a true melting pot of cultures, with a rich history and a bright future. So if you are an adventurous spirit looking to explore new and exciting places, China is the perfect destination.</p>画面が切り替わりますので、しばらくお待ち下さい。 ※ご購入は、楽天kobo商品ページからお願いします。※切り替わらない場合は、こちら をクリックして下さい。 ※このページからは注文できません。
